Alyssa was shopping with her son at Target one day when she had an unexpected encounter with a total stranger. After the whole experience, she had to share the story with her friends on Facebook. Along with the photo directly below, she wrote the following words.

This momma just cried in the middle of Target. We were at target waiting on Grammi and we found some dinosaurs.

Owen grabbed all 3 and we were trying to pick out which one he wanted when Owen abruptly yelled, “Hi” at this older man walking past us. He turned around and said, “hey sweet boy.” He proceeded to play dinosaurs with Owen and with this crazy world we live in I was a little hesitant as too how close he was with Owen.

The man got his wallet and pulled out a $20. He put it in Owens pocket on his shirt and said, “I just lost my 2-year-old grandson last week. You take this money and buy this boy all three dinosaurs,” rubbed Owen’s back, wiped his tears, and walked off.

After Owen yelled, “thank you,” the gentleman turned around and yelled, “boomer sooner!” There is still some good in this world!
